Description

In medical contexts, a 'sender' refers to an individual or entity that transmits information, samples, or communications related to patient care or medical records. This term is often used in the context of referrals or laboratory testing.

Interpreter Notes

Interpreters should be aware that 'remitente' is the formal term used in clinical settings, while 'despachador' may be heard in more informal contexts. It is important to maintain a professional tone and avoid colloquial variants that may arise in conversation.

Example Sentences

EN: The sender of the medical records must ensure that all information is complete and accurate.

ES: El remitente de los registros médicos debe asegurarse de que toda la información sea completa y precisa.

Common Interpreter Mistakes

Confusing 'remitente' with 'despachador' in formal contexts; misinterpreting the role of the sender in patient referrals; mixing up with similar-sounding terms like 'remitente' and 'recipiente'.
